At Hoveton & Wroxham, you won't find a traditional ticket office, but fear not. The station is equipped with ticket machines,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online conveniently. These machines are user-friendly and accessible, ensuring that everyone can obtain their tickets with ease. There is an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, and customer help points provide assistance when staff is on site.
Accessibility at the station has been thoughtfully considered. Step-free access is available to both platforms through separate pathways, although note there is no step-free access between platforms directly. The station is bicycle-friendly, with ample storage space, though there are no cycle hire facilities available.
The station has excellent connections to local transport services, making onward travel a breeze. There are rail replacement services that operate from the lay-by outside the main entrance on Belaugh Road, ensuring that travelers can always find a way to continue their journey despite any rail disruptions.

Leasowe is a station that offers a thoughtful mix of essential services to ensure a smooth travel experience. Tickets can be purchased and collected at the ticket office, which operates Monday to Sunday from early morning until midnight. Unfortunately, while there are no ticket machines, the ticket office also serves those who purchased their journeys online for easy collection.
Accessibility is a priority at Leasowe, with a step-free environment throughout the station, making it a Category A facility. Additional assistance for travelers with reduced mobility includes ramp access to platforms and accessible spaces in the car park. For your peace of mind, comprehensive CCTV coverage is available across the station premises.
Though there are no shops, refreshment facilities, or ATMs on-site, you can rest in the seating areas or access the provided toilets (please note there are no baby changing facilities). While waiting for your train, enjoy peace of mind with waiting rooms and help points strategically placed around the station.
Despite the lack of a dedicated taxi rank, Leasowe station still offers several transport options to get you to your destination. If you're catching a plane, Rail/bus tickets are available straight to Liverpool John Lennon Airport without the hassle of buying separate tickets. Buses like the 86A and 80A connect from Liverpool South Parkway to the airport in about ten minutes.
For replacement bus services, the station itself doesn't host a stop, but options are available at nearby Reeds Lane. For additional onward travel connections, including local information, you can visit the Merseytravel website or contact their Traveline service.
